Red carpet fashion Oscars 2021: A glimpse of normalcy at star-studded event

At a pandemic-era Oscars, it was never going to be business as usual on the red carpet.

But with a scaled back ceremony, organizers tried their very best to recapture the glamour that the showpiece event is known for. And the stars in attendance did their part, too, wearing an array of dramatic golds, reds and daring cutouts.

Usually held in February, the Oscars were pushed back by over two months in the hopes that loosening Covid-19 restrictions would allow for a more lavish affair. Indeed, with attendees not required to wear masks for the cameras, and eveningwear from some of fashion’s biggest names on display, there were glimpses of normalcy on the red carpet at the end of a largely virtual awards season.

The 93rd annual Academy Awards took place across two LA venues: the Dolby Theatre and Union Station, where up to 170 guests, nominees and presenters were permitted to gather.
